Output 43500d6626d7d68cb0e71d30c26b164a8fa0b2c8ca485e082cc5a1012f2403ee:0

value
5978160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 525898032b01c94ca85f79e71d629053f3277888 OP_EQUAL
address
39CRTsvn78HmEeJqrdFaDDxDZu1jc6tVMk
transaction
43500d6626d7d68cb0e71d30c26b164a8fa0b2c8ca485e082cc5a1012f2403ee
spent
true